A terrific pressing of this 1974 Aussie gate-fold issued LP from Rats (so named as it is STAR spelt backwards!)  ... a London rock-band that features singer-writer David Kubinec plus the 3 members of CWT who delivered one and only album, the ultra/ mega-rare and heavy-prog rock monster 'The Hundredweight' a year earlier ... then promptly split from the singer. Enter David and the new somewhat unconventional quartet (assembled by producer Adrian Millar) emerged with this album which in itself is a terrific mid-70's UK glam-based rock  ... not dissimilar from The Faces and probably closer to Bowies band musically but layered with Kubinec's Bolan-esque style vocals.
Before the LP hit the shops however 2 of the 3 CWT members (guitarist Graeme Quinton-Jones and drummer Colin White) exited over differences with Adrian Millar ; I note that Graeme Quinton-Jones turned up in UK prog outfit Gizmo a little later. Miller quickly patched things up with Roddy MacKenzie and Jeff Allen as respective replacements, even getting the photo of the new line-up on the inside gatefold cover here despite neither of the two new lads ever playing or recording a note or beat with the group.
It also seems that this new line-up of David Kubinec ; Peter Kirke ; Roddy MacKenzie and Jeff Allen did in fact lay tracks down for a 2nd album which never eventuated. These tapes re-surfaced some 30 years on and an archival CD of these recordings was released in 2009 titled ' Second Long Player Record'.    

The  lack of continuity, or even reality, in those days made it difficult to market a band and accordingly any album which resulted was only ever issued in limited quantities rather than the numbers associated with a proper release.
